More than 180 anglers plus tournament staff were welcomed to the Clinton area with “swag bags” consisting of tourist information, promotional items from area businesses, and River City Gold to be used at participating restaurants and businesses. Daily weigh-ins were staged with the Bassmaster official scales in the parking lot of the Candlelight Inn and Clinton Marina, with the final win going to Steve Lee from Minneapolis, Minnesota, who secured his win with a three-day total of 42 pounds, 14 ounces. The fishing competition began Wednesday morning with all boats in the water and ready to launch by 5:30 am. The tournament kicked off with registration and packet pick up on Tuesday, June 28, held at the Eagle Point Lodge. Nation Northern Regional tournament held in Clinton, Iowa, from June 28-July 1 this year was a success, drawing more than 200 people from nine Midwestern states to the Greater Clinton Region for multiple days of competition and boasting an economic impact of $142,500 for the Clinton area. With a famous dish named after the cook who brought it into the restaurant, the four Candlelight Inn Restaurants now serve an average of 6,000 pounds of Chicken George each week. The news of this new chicken recipe spread and resulted in people coming in requesting it even before it was put on the menu! Word of mouth made Chicken George famous. Bob told him to ask for “Chicken George”, incorporating the name of the cook who made the dish. Roger loved them and asked Bob what he should ask for when he came in to eat the next time. Even Bob hadn't tried them yet! Bob asked George to fix some up for Roger, and the rest is history. He then fried them up and served them – to himself. Roger asked Bob for “something different.” Immediately, Bob thought about his fry cook George's new dish.Ī little backstory, one day, George de-boned and cut up chicken breasts and then lightly battered them. One of his regulars, a gentleman named Roger Young, came in to dine. In the early 1970s, Bob Prescott, founder, and father of the current Candlelight Inn owner, Matt, was busy serving his guests at the Candlelight Inn at the 100th block of West Third in downtown Sterling.
